how 2 design a mod 6 synchronous counter using jk flip flop?

Answer Posted / d.g.bhat

mod-6 counter has 6 states,i.e, 0 to 5.
the binary form of 6 is 110, therefore 3 jk flipflops are
required to represent each bit. the ic used is 7476 or 74112.
first one should be clear with exitation table of jk.
then we should construct the transition table consisting of
present states, next states and flip flop inputs.. then
using this table k-map should be filled to obtain the design
equations for the circiut.lastly circiut should be
implemented and should be checked for proper working.
